Product Designer
Designs beautiful, detailed products for investment management platform used by financial institutions managing trillions in assets. Requires 2+ years experience, passion for details, independent problem-solving, and effective use of AI prototyping tools.
About the job
Responsibilities
- Design products for financial institutions' trading, operations, and infrastructure workflows.
- Build the foundation and set design standards for tools in the wealth management space.
- Experiment, prototype, and validate ideas, designs, and workflows using AI tools.
Requirements
- At least 2 years of experience designing products.
- Belief that all products can and should be beautiful.
- Care about tiny details and user feel.
- Willingness and ability to independently figure things out.
- Effective use of AI tools for experimentation, prototyping, and validation.
Nice-to-Haves
- Experience working on complex B2B products.
- Experience building products from scratch.
Compensation & Benefits
- Salary range: $175,000 to $275,000 (varies based on skills, experience, and interview performance).
- Equity package.
- Comprehensive wellness package (health, dental, vision with 100% company reimbursement for most plans).
- Gym stipends ($150).
- Flexible PTO (average 3 weeks/year).
- 401k with 4% employer match.
- Paid lunches in office daily via Uber Eats ($25/meal) and free UberOne membership.
